Evaluating Rare Coins and Currency

Authentication Methods

Rick Harrison relies on a mix of historical research, visual inspection, and trusted grading services to confirm the legitimacy of rare coins and currency. This process helps protect both buyers and sellers from counterfeit or misrepresented items.

Market Value Assessment

Determining market value involves analyzing recent sales, rarity, condition, and collector demand. Harrison often explains how these factors interact to influence final pricing in dynamic markets.

Building a Sustainable Collection Strategy

  • Set clear goals, whether focusing on coins, currency, or memorabilia
  • Research market trends and recent auction results before purchasing
  • Verify authenticity through trusted grading services when possible
  • Document condition, provenance, and acquisition details for every item
  • Diversify across categories to manage risk and opportunity
  • Work with reputable dealers like Rick Harrison for transparent transactions
  • Review and update collections periodically to reflect market changes
